Vietnamese ordinary passport holders need a visa to visit Bosnia and Herzegovina. There is no e-visa or visa-on-arrival; you must apply for a short-stay (Type C) sticker visa in advance at a Bosnian embassy or consulate. One exception: if you already hold a valid multiple-entry Schengen, EU or US visa (or residence permit), you may enter visa-free for up to 30 days. Bosnia and Herzegovina is not part of the Schengen Area but is an EU candidate country that applies a visa policy closely aligned with Schengen. Vietnam is not on its visa-exemption list, so Vietnamese citizens travelling on an ordinary passport for tourism must obtain a short-stay (Type C) visa before departure. Bosnia does not operate an e-visa portal for Vietnamese nationals and does not grant visa on arrival; applications are made at a Bosnian diplomatic mission. Because Bosnia has no embassy in Vietnam, applicants typically apply through the accredited Bosnian mission covering Vietnam (commonly handled via missions in the region or by post). The standard short-stay visa permits stays of up to 90 days within a 180-day period. A practical alternative widely used by travellers: anyone holding a valid multiple-entry Schengen visa, an EU member-state visa, a US visa, or a residence permit in any of those areas may enter Bosnia visa-free for up to 30 days. ETIAS is not relevant to this route (it applies to Bosnians entering the EU, not Vietnamese entering Bosnia). Given that no confirmed visa-free, e-visa, or visa-on-arrival channel exists for Vietnamese ordinary passports, the conservative and correct verdict is visa-required.
